How you'll make an impact in this role

  • Design precise treatment plans to deliver targeted radiation doses under the direction of medical physicist and radiation oncologist, directly contributing to successful patient outcomes and tumor management.
  • Assist with or perform the fabrication of beam modifying devices and immobilization devices.
  • Perform specialized brachytherapy procedures in close collaboration with the care team to provide high-precision, localized treatment.
  • Provide technical support for equipment calibrations and radiation protection, ensuring the highest standards of safety and care quality for patients and staff.
  • Collaborate on innovative clinical research and dosimetry projects alongside medical physicists to continuously elevate radiation therapy practices.

What minimum qualifications you'll need

Licensure/Certification/Registration:

  • Certified Medical Dosimetrist credentialed from the Medical Dosimetrist Certification Board obtained within 36 Months (3 years) of hire date or job transfer date required.

Education:

  • High School diploma equivalency with 2 years of cumulative experience OR Associate's degree/Technical degree OR 4 years of applicable cumulative job specific experience required.

What additional requirements you'll need

  • Certified Medical Dosimetrist or enrolled in a program to become CMD credentialed.
  • Radiation therapist experience.
